XYT Diamond Polishing Film is a microabrasive product with diamond micron-graded grains slurry coated on high precision 75 µm / 3 mil film, which gives a high-accuracy finishing and excellent flexibility and durability.
It can be used either dry or water emulsion.
XYT Diamond Polishing Film comes in various forms for use in different application techniques.
The main applications for XYT Diamond Polishing film are lapping and polishing processes of hard materials likes carbides, ceramics, metals, glass, fiber optic connectors and other finishing and lapping process.
It is available in PSA (Pressure Sentitive Adhesive) as discs, sheets and rolls.

Mesh | 180 | 240 | 360 | 400 | 600 | 1000 | 1200 | 2000 | 2500 | 4000 | 6000 | 8000 | 10000 |
Particle Size(µm) | 80 | 60 | 45 | 40 | 30 | 16 | 15 | 9 | 6 | 3 | 2 | 1 | 0.5 |

Ceramic Connector Polishing
Step | Polishing Film | Process | Lifetime | ||||
Micron | Mineral | Product | Pad | Liquid | Time | ||
Remove Epoxy | 30µm | Diamond | D30 | 80 D | DI water | 30-35s | >30 plates |
Rough Polishing | 9µm | Diamond | D9 | 80 D | DI water | 30-35s | >30 plates |
Fine Polishing | 1µm | Diamond | D1 | 80 D | DI water | 35-40s | >30 plates |
Final Polishing | 0.02µm | SiO2 | SO/ADS | 70 D | DI water | 30-40s | >10 plates |
What’s more, the life time of XYT Diamond Laping Film is over 30 plates, while XYT's ADS is over 10 plates, which will help you save a great amount of cost.
During the process please use our suggested polish pads, do the cleaning accordingly and set the working time correctly, so you will get the ideal finish for your Ceramic Connectors.
